## Escalation: Sensor Drift (Verdantia Controller)

If the Greenhaus dashboard shows humidity readings drifting more than 5% against the reference probe, don't panic — it's usually a calibration lag, not a hardware failure. First, trigger a recalibration from the Verdantia console and wait fifteen minutes. If drift persists, mark the bay as degraded and page the hardware rotation. Still stuck after that? Escalate directly to the sensor platform lead.

billing contact of yawip-yadup = druath.casdor@nelvrolabs.internal

Subject: DR drill Thursday — export retries

Hi folks, welcome aboard! Thursday we're running the quarterly disaster-recovery drill for Shipshape, our export pipeline. We'll deliberately fail a batch of exports and practice the retry flow: drain the dead-letter queue, replay in order, verify checksums. New joiners just shadow this time. You'll need access to the drill vault to follow along, and its recovery passphrase is:

vault phrase of kawep-tahog = ulaix-briath

Night shift: evacuation-chair store on Stairwell C, Level 3, was restocked today. Two Havermont chairs serviced, one sent to Drayle Safety for repair. Check the seal on the store door at 02:00 rounds. If the seal is broken, log it and re-secure. Door access for the store uses the pass below.

staff pass of fajop-kajop = bdg-H-83

== Document Transport: Drone Return Procedure ==

When a Wrenfield courier drone is returned for servicing, the office manager must verify that all document pouches have been removed and logged before the unit leaves the premises. Pack the drone in its foam cradle, attach the service tag, and stage it at reception. When the service courier arrives, apply the confidential hand-over instruction recorded below:

handover note for yagef-bagep: the drudor pelius courier leaves the kasdor zorvan norir ledger at gate 8016 under passcode 755406